Position Summary

Reporting to the Canadian HSE Director; the Oshawa HSE Manager is responsible for the development and maintenance of Health and Safety, and Environmental programs within the Oshawa and USA Installations Operations. The Oshawa HSE Manager will participate in cross functional teams to drive safety, continuous improvement, waste reduction, and environmental sustainability. The Oshawa HSE Manager provides guidance to the organization from policy creation to operational HSE plans and implementation. This role is to effectively and efficiently manage the development and direction of the HSE team. The Oshawa HSE Manager will ensure that all Oshawa facilities as well as the USA installations operations are following applicable Federal, State/provincial, and Municipal EHS regulatory requirements.

Responsibilities:

Ensures HSE team delivers agreed-upon results by communicating job expectations; planning, monitoring, and appraising job results, using the P+ Prysmian, People, Performance process; coaching, counselling, and disciplining employees; initiating, coordinating, and enforcing systems, policies, and procedures with the assistance of the Human Resources (HR) Dept. and approved policies & procedures. Recommends merit increases and administers approved bonus structure for the HSE Department as per approved procedures.

Strategic Planning: Working with the mission and goals, designs, revises, implements, and continuously evaluates HSE goals and strategies to ensure they support the overall goals and meet customer and legislative requirements. Develop and implement new business strategies for creating or improving processes and procedures utilizing Risk Rank down to improve corporate HSE performance.

Health & Safety, and Environment (HSE) and Integrated Management System

Develop, implement, and maintain policies and procedures for HSE.

  • Review and analyze HSE data and create action steps to drive improved performance.

  • Promote and raise global awareness of the impact of changing HSE requirements, whether legislated or best practices, on corporate responsibility.

  • Develop and implement HSE management systems, processes, and procedures that improve business operations in accordance with ISO 14001, and ISO 45001 as well as the Prysmian HSE management systems for NA operations. Keep up to date with changes in HSE legislation, international standards, and best practice initiatives.

  • Conduct risk assessments to identify, assess, and reduce the Organization’s HSE risks. Updates risk assessments with business, regulatory or other significant changes.

  • Conduct safety, and environmental audits in all BU Canadian locations as well as USA Installations to ensure compliance, evaluate performance, identify corrective action, and implement follow up assessments.

  • Review audit reports from all EEBU NA locations and support as needed.

  • Investigate all accidents, incidents, and near misses to determine cause and recommend measures to prevent future occurrences and implement preventive measures.

  • Responsible for preparing, presenting, and following up on actions for HSE Management Review meetings. Work with the Quality manager as an ISO Management Representative communicate information on the HSE Management System and promote HSE culture throughout the organization.

  • Responsible for taking on the leadership role in maintaining a safe and healthy work environment by establishing, following, enforcing and promoting Health & Safety policies and procedures; adhering to current and local legislation; by attending Health and Safety Committee meetings and consistently promoting health & safety to employees.

  • Is responsible for leading and establishing, following, enforcing, and promoting policies, procedures, goals, and strategies to reduce the impact to the environment as a result of business activities.

  • Obtain all required permits and renewals, complete all required reports, filings, and other documentation as required by state/provincial, federal, and local government agencies to maintain EHS compliance in NA.

  • In coordination with local NA HSE, manage all HSE activities involving hazardous chemicals, electrical safety, work exposures, hazardous and non-hazardous waste storage and disposal, fire protection equipment, spill kits, emergency drills and first aid supplies.

  • Interface with federal, state or provincial and local government agencies (i.e., OHSA, OSHA, EPA, MOE, etc.) and Prysmian corporate when necessary to ensure ongoing compliance.

  • Support new equipment installations and facility construction projects as required, assigning local team leader for EHS activities including contractor safety training.

  • Manage Hazard Communication programs to ensure compliance with regulations.

Training: Develop & present in-house HSE training workshops and/or manage outside training associates in conjunction with the Human Resources Department to meet our goals as required. Ensure employees can recognize and understand their contributions to improving HSE performance.

Reports: Responsible for providing the following reports: Managing the Parent ST chart, HSE Reports on progress and achievements against the annual plan and activities including Management Review.

Professional & Technology Knowledge: Maintain professional and technical knowledge by attending educational workshops, reviewing professional publications.

Special Projects: Provide support with special projects relating to Health and Safety, and Environmental programs within the North American Operations.
